30 Day Money Back Guarantee
Fast Delivery
Lowest Price Guarantee
Puma Basket Classic AC Boys Toddler Shoes - Black ZV31648
Puma Basket Classic AC Boys Toddler Shoes - White EO03784
Puma Basket Paper Plane Boys Toddler Shoes - Blue RV89102
Puma Basket Paper Plane Boys Toddler Shoes - White UX34276
Puma Future Rider Arctic Boys Toddler Shoes - White KH07259
Puma Future Rider City Attack AC Boys Toddler Shoes - Grey HF93286
Puma Future Rider City Attack AC Boys Toddler Shoes - Orange YR36918
Puma GV Special Boys Toddler Shoes - Black NE45671
Puma GV Special Boys Toddler Shoes - Navy WP43725
Puma GV Special Boys Toddler Shoes - White FK90471
Puma Mercedes-AMG Petronas F1 Roma Boys Toddler Shoes - Black UN35791
Puma Mercedes-AMG Petronas F1 Roma Boys Toddler Shoes - White HN85462
Puma Ralph Sampson Animals Boys Toddler Shoes - Beige GF40317
Puma Ralph Sampson Animals Boys Toddler Shoes - Black JV65931
Puma Ralph Sampson Low AC Boys Toddler Shoes - Black UI23581
Puma Ralph Sampson Low AC Boys Toddler Shoes - White ZX43126
Puma Roma Basic Boys Toddler Shoes - Black JQ26017
Puma Roma Basic Boys Toddler Shoes - Black RJ63194
Puma Roma Basic Boys Toddler Shoes - White TQ70231
Puma Roma Basic Boys Toddler Shoes - White WI18572
Puma RS-2K Internet Exploring Boys Toddler Shoes - Purple IW19754
Puma RS-Fast Boys Toddler Shoes - Black YB18596
Puma RS-Fast Boys Toddler Shoes - Red EO13872
Puma RS-Fast Boys Toddler Shoes - White HJ19485